Transaction 22e6a7452183ad5658e4edf8c5c3299ef8476a8253f166fe5ad0a29c47faf02b

2 Input
2 Outputs
  • 22e6a7452183ad5658e4edf8c5c3299ef8476a8253f166fe5ad0a29c47faf02b:0
  • value  25140203
    address  3BYSaVHsoUPyQU8Hx3zbHwLc3AWBwYhoBG
  • 22e6a7452183ad5658e4edf8c5c3299ef8476a8253f166fe5ad0a29c47faf02b:1
  • value  11708322
    address  3LDrGsrWDqRxHiMitcXGV7TKVhx2XC73pL